magnus motorsports
4G64: (A 2.4L 4G63? Yep.)
Stepping the ante up one more time in the quest for more hp, we developed the 2.4L DOHC 4G63/4G64 engine swap for 1st and 2nd generation DSM's. Providing more than 130 extra ft/lbs of torque and 50 more hp. Piloted our race car to an astonishing 10.06 @ 140 mph without the aid of Nitrous, and a new best of 9.623 second ET with a 152mph BEST. Still being able to rev until 8500 RPM.
